Stone masonry repair services focus on restoring and preserving the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of stone structures. These services typically involve assessing existing stonework, identifying areas of deterioration, and implementing appropriate repair techniques. Common methods include repointing mortar joints, replacing damaged stones, cleaning surfaces, and applying protective treatments to prevent future decay. Skilled professionals work carefully to match the original materials and craftsmanship, ensuring that repairs blend seamlessly with the existing structure.
This type of repair service addresses a variety of issues that can compromise the stability and appearance of stone features. Over time, exposure to weather, moisture, and temperature fluctuations can cause stones to crack, crumble, or shift. Mortar joints may deteriorate, leading to leaks or further damage. Repairing these problems helps prevent more extensive structural failures, reduces the risk of water infiltration, and maintains the overall durability of the property. Proper stone masonry repair also helps preserve historical features, preventing the loss of architectural details.

The overview below groups typical Stone Masonry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Barberton,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Labor Costs - Masonry repair labor typically ranges from $50 to $100 per hour, depending on the complexity of the work and local rates. For a small repair, labor might cost around $200, while larger projects could reach $1,000 or more.
Material Expenses - The cost of materials such as stone or mortar varies from $10 to $50 per square foot. For example, replacing a 50-square-foot section could range from $500 to $2,500 depending on material choices.
Project Size and Scope - Smaller repairs, like fixing cracks or replacing a few stones, may cost between $300 and $1,000. Larger repairs involving extensive rebuilding can range from $2,000 to over $10,000.
Additional Costs - Permitting, site preparation, or specialized restoration services can add to the overall price, often ranging from $200 to $1,000 or more based on project specifics. These costs vary depending on local regulations and project compl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of stone masonry repair services are available? Local service providers offer repairs for cracked or damaged stones, repointing mortar joints, restoring historic stonework, and cleaning or sealing stone surfaces.
How can I tell if my stonework needs repair? Signs such as cracking, shifting, spalling, or deterioration of mortar and stones indicate that repair services may be necessary.
What are common causes of stone damage? Damage often results from weathering, freeze-thaw cycles, moisture infiltration, or structural movement.
Are there different repair methods for various types of stone? Yes, repair techniques vary depending on the stone type, including limestone, granite, sandstone, or marble, to ensure proper restoration.
